Abstract
The application provides the control method of a kind of electronic device and electronic device, electronic device includes display screen, center and turning mould group, center mutually covers conjunction with display screen, center has the side wall around display screen setting, center is corresponding to be equipped with overturning accommodating chamber close to display screen edge, overturning accommodating chamber has the accommodating chamber opening for being opened in side wall, accommodating chamber opening towards parallel display panel, turning mould group includes overturning seat, and it is fixed on the called device and picture pick-up device of overturning seat, overturning seat is rotationally connected with overturning receiving chamber inner sidewall, and the shaft axial direction parallel display panel of overturning seat, overturning seat outer wall is equipped with the first sound mouth for called device sounding, overturning seat turns to the state for being contained in overturning accommodating chamber with respect to center, first sound mouth is open towards accommodating chamber.The sound of called device avoids through the first sound mouth and the externally transmission of accommodating chamber opening and opens up sound mouth in display screen, improve the appearance property of electronic device.

Technical field
This application involves technical field of electronic equipment, and in particular to the control method of a kind of electronic device and electronic device.
Background technique
Need to open up sound mouth on display screen in mobile phone at present, allow the called device of interior of mobile phone by it is above-mentioned go out
Sound mouth carries out sounding, however display screen opens up the structure of sound mouth, is unfavorable for the design of mobile phone.
